Meta is taking over downtown…

Meta is taking over downtown…

Meta is leasing up all the office space in Austin’s tallest tower…

Not only are they planning to take over all 589,000 square feet of office space (across 33 floors), they’re looking to hire hundreds all while keeping their other downtown offices.

2021 Q3 Market Update

2021 Q3 Market Update

Q3 2021 ended with the market finally experiencing price stabilization while values still moved up 3-4% and supply ended at 1.11 months.  20% over list to win a home in multiple offers finally subsided, the number of multiple offers banded down and terms loosened a touch for Buyers.
